From 42ec7c09426101edce7bf658d68a6ddafeadcc4a Mon Sep 17 00:00:00 2001 From: "Geisler, James D" Date: Mon, 14 Jun 2021 13:20:29 -0500 Subject: [PATCH] add environment variables to jaeger oauth sidecar Signed-off-by: Geisler, James D --- charts/jaeger/Chart.yaml | 2 +- charts/jaeger/templates/query-deploy.yaml | 4 ++++ charts/jaeger/values.yaml | 1 + 3 files changed, 6 insertions(+), 1 deletion(-) diff --git a/charts/jaeger/Chart.yaml b/charts/jaeger/Chart.yaml index 050f83dc..3b747f2f 100644 --- a/charts/jaeger/Chart.yaml +++ b/charts/jaeger/Chart.yaml @@ -3,7 +3,7 @@ appVersion: 1.22.0 description: A Jaeger Helm chart for Kubernetes name: jaeger type: application -version: 0.46.0 +version: 0.46.1 keywords: - jaeger - opentracing diff --git a/charts/jaeger/templates/query-deploy.yaml b/charts/jaeger/templates/query-deploy.yaml index 4bce2e5f..7809b676 100644 --- a/charts/jaeger/templates/query-deploy.yaml +++ b/charts/jaeger/templates/query-deploy.yaml @@ -132,6 +132,10 @@ spec: {{- range .Values.query.oAuthSidecar.args }} - {{ . }} {{- end }} + {{- if .Values.query.oAuthSidecar.extraEnv }} + env: + {{- toYaml .Values.query.oAuthSidecar.extraEnv | nindent 10 }} + {{- end }} volumeMounts: {{- range .Values.query.oAuthSidecar.extraConfigmapMounts }} - name: {{ .name }} diff --git a/charts/jaeger/values.yaml b/charts/jaeger/values.yaml index dd591713..15777dd5 100644 --- a/charts/jaeger/values.yaml +++ b/charts/jaeger/values.yaml @@ -381,6 +381,7 @@ query: pullPolicy: IfNotPresent containerPort: 4180 args: [] + extraEnv: [] extraConfigmapMounts: [] extraSecretMounts: [] podSecurityContext: {}